About Fasheng Sun
Fasheng Sun is a scholar working on Management Science and Operations Research, Computational Theory and Mathematics and Statistics, Probability and Uncertainty, having authored 37 papers that have together received 472 indexed citations. Recurring topics across this work include Advanced Multi-Objective Optimization Algorithms (25 papers), Optimal Experimental Design Methods (24 papers) and Manufacturing Process and Optimization (8 papers). The work is most often cited by research in Management Science and Operations Research (319 citations), Computational Theory and Mathematics (307 citations) and Statistics, Probability and Uncertainty (88 citations). Fasheng Sun has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Min‐Qian Liu, Dennis K. J. Lin, Hongquan Xu, Boxin Tang, Yaping Wang, Jian‐Feng Yang, Long Feng, Long Zhao, Chunwu Yang and Rahul Mukerjee. Their work appears in journals such as Journal of the American Statistical Association, Technometrics and Biometrika.
